Choosing between yarn winders & project bags starts with one practical question: do you need to turn yarn into a neat ball, or keep an active knitting or crochet project organized? The Stanwood Needlecraft is a dedicated hand-powered winder, while the Knitting Bag Yarn Storage Tote is designed around carrying yarn, tools, and accessories. They solve different problems, so the better choice depends on the task you want handled first.

Where each product wins

Stanwood Needlecraft

The Stanwood wins when a skein needs to become a center-pull ball. Its hand-powered operation keeps the setup straightforward, and the description specifies 3-millimeter-thick steel with a rust-resistant powder coating plus a reinforced nylon gear. Those details make it the more directly aligned choice for winding sessions rather than general project transport.

Knitting Bag Yarn Storage Tote

The tote wins for portable organization. Its carrying handle, front pocket, and three anti-tangle grommet holes support a project-bag routine: yarn can feed through the grommets while hooks, needles, or small accessories stay in the pocket. That arrangement is more useful when the immediate need is to gather supplies and carry an ongoing project.
